Main Areas of Responsibility: 

New Mexico School for the Arts – Art Institute is seeking an energetic, self-motivated team player with proven fundraising talent and work ethic, excited by challenges, and determined to meet goals set by the President. Arts background a plus. Key responsibilities include planning and executing fundraising events, organizing and tracking donor data using donor CRM, coordinating volunteers and interns, cultivating prospects, etc. Excellent written and verbal communication skills required.

Additional Areas of Responsibility: 

The primary responsibility of the Director of Development is to enthusiastically present the mission and outcomes of NM School for the Arts to all donors and partners and potential donors and partners. The Director of Development leads the efforts in the identification of and relationship building with key donors and groups in order to ensure that the organization receives a steady and sufficient amount of funding.
